On overland corridors (such as the Silk Road routes spanning China to Poland/Germany), temperature variations and physical vibration threaten sophisticated industrial tooling. Our localized intervention utilizes ABS Anti-Lock Braking System skeleton semitrailers coupled with 3PL repacking. This reduces axial shock forces by up to 40% and guarantees compliance with UNECE vehicle requirements.
Dangerous Goods (including Class 9 lithium batteries and pressurized canisters) require strict adherence to international maritime (IMDG) and air transit (IATA) codes. We deploy localized certified packaging houses at port cities to execute over-packing, dynamic stabilization, and compliant labeling. This ensures that DDP customs clearance is processed without detention risk.
Entering USA/Canada borders requires meticulous classification, bond management, and compliance auditing. Through integrated custom house broker (CHB) operations, we verify harmonized tariff schedule (HTS) entries at origin. This prevents administrative holds, mitigating demurrage costs at container terminals such as Los Angeles, Long Beach, and New York.

Why South China clusters offer unmatched structural agility and systemic logistics efficiency.
The manufacturing capabilities of South China, particularly the Greater Bay Area, go beyond raw capacity. It relies on a dense network of raw material processing, electronic sub-assembly, surface finishing, and logistical nodes. An OEM/ODM partner operating in this cluster benefits from immediate component availability, which minimizes raw material storage costs and shortens production lead times.
When unexpected disruptions occur, such as port congestions or maritime route changes, this ecosystem quickly adapts. Integrated forwarders can reroute cargo from ocean corridors to intermodal trucking routes (like China-Europe Express routes) within 24 hours. The close proximity of components, container manufacturing plants, and deep-water ports creates a strong shield against supply chain shocks.
Aligning manufacturing and logistics with global regulatory standards to protect your cargo.
A major risk in cross-border OEM/ODM sourcing is importing non-compliant equipment or parts. Structural container elements, such as carbon steel quick-opening cams, must meet clear strength requirements and secure ISO9001 or CE certifications. Similarly, transport equipment like skeleton semitrailers must comply with national braking standards, which requires integrated ABS systems.
Our localized support structure ensures all required paperwork is handled at the point of origin. We verify CE certificate authenticity, perform load-bearing tests, and arrange pre-shipment inspections. This process prevents importing substandard materials, protecting your operations from legal liabilities, warehouse accidents, and customs delays at destination ports.
